Neha Dhupia has been a part of the industry for over a decade. The actress is known for her versatile characters. Now, in an exclusive segment of mid-day’s The Bombay Film Story, Neha Dhupia surprised many by revealing that her first film was not a Bollywood project but a Japanese movie titled Ninja Odoru Ninja Densetsu. Speaking candidly, the actor opened up about the little-known chapter of her career and the unique experience of making her debut at just 19 years old in a foreign country. 

Neha Dhupia talks about her first film 

“My first film was a Japanese film,” Neha said, laughing as she added, “Yes, I’m an international movie star, guys. I am.” When asked why the film is rarely discussed, she admitted, “Nobody speaks about it. I would love to watch this film myself… I don’t know what’s going on, but I was a part of a Japanese film.”
